use std::{
cell::RefCell,
sync::Arc,
};
use super::Color;
thread_local! {
static ACTIVE_THEME: RefCell<Theme> = const { RefCell::new(Theme::Dark) };
static ACTIVE_PALETTE: RefCell<Option<PaletteHandle>> = const { RefCell::new(None) };
}
pub type PaletteHandle = Arc<dyn Palette>;
#[derive(Clone, Copy, Debug, PartialEq, Eq, Default, Hash)]
pub enum Theme {
Light,
#[default]
Dark,
}
impl Theme {
pub fn set(theme: Theme) {
ACTIVE_THEME.with(|t| *t.borrow_mut() = theme);
}
pub fn current() -> Self {
ACTIVE_THEME.with(|t| *t.borrow())
}
pub fn set_palette(palette: PaletteHandle) {
ACTIVE_PALETTE.with(|p| *p.borrow_mut() = Some(palette));
}
pub fn clear_palette() {
ACTIVE_PALETTE.with(|p| *p.borrow_mut() = None);
}
pub fn has_palette() -> bool {
ACTIVE_PALETTE.with(|p| p.borrow().is_some())
}
pub fn palette() -> PaletteHandle {
ACTIVE_PALETTE.with(|p| match p.borrow().as_ref() {
| Some(handle) => Arc::clone(handle),
| None => Arc::new(Self::current()),
})
}
pub fn with<T>(theme: Theme, f: impl FnOnce() -> T) -> T {
let previous_theme = Self::current();
let previous_palette = Self::palette_option();
Self::set(theme);
Self::clear_palette();
let result = f();
Self::set(previous_theme);
match previous_palette {
| Some(palette) => Self::set_palette(palette),
| None => Self::clear_palette(),
}
result
}
fn palette_option() -> Option<PaletteHandle> {
ACTIVE_PALETTE.with(|p| p.borrow().as_ref().map(Arc::clone))
}
}
